Bài 11: CÁC THAO TÁC VỚI CƠ SỞ DỮ LIỆU QUAN HỆ
1. Tạo lập cơ sở dữ liệu Bước 1: tạo bảng
Để tạo lập CSDL quan hệ là tạo ra một hay nhiều bảng. Để thực hiện cần phải xác định và khai báo cấu trúc bảng, gồm:
- Đặt tên các trường
- Chỉ định kiểu dữ liệu cho mỗi trường - Khai báo kích thước của trường Bước 2: chọn khóa chính
- Xác định khóa thích hợp trong các khóa của bảng hoặc để hệ QTCSDL tự động chọn
Bước 3: đặt tên và lưu cấu trúc bảng Bước 4: tạo liên kết bảng
- Bằng cách xác định các trường chung trong các bảng.
2. Cập nhật dữ liệu : ta có thể thêm, xóa, sửa dữ liệu, cụ thể:
Thêm: bằng cách nhập (bổ sung) một hoặc một vài bộ dữ liệu.
Sửa: là thay đổi các giá trị của một vài thuộc tính của một bộ
Xóa: là việc xóa một hoặc một số bộ của bảng 3. Khai thác cơ sở dữ liệu
a. Sắp xếp các bản ghi : Ta có thể sắp xếp các bản ghi theo nội dung của một hay nhiều trường.
Ví dụ: sắp xếp danh sách học sinh theo bảng chữ cái của trường tên (Ten), hoặc theo thứ tự giảm dần của ngày sinh (NgaySinh), …
b. Truy vấn cơ sở dữ liệu
Truy vấn là một phát biểu thể hiện yêu cầu của người dùng. Truy vấn mô tả các dữ liệu và thiết lập các tiêu chí để hệ QTCSDL có thể thu thập dữ liệu thích hợp; đó là một dạng lọc, có khả năng thu thập thông tin từ nhiều bảng trong một CSDL quan hệ.
c. Xem dữ liệu - Xem toàn bộ bảng:
- Xem một tập con các bản ghi hoặc một số trường trong bảng thông qua công cụ lọc dữ liệu.
- Xem các bản ghi thông qua biểu mẫu
Ví dụ: dùng biểu mẫu xem kết quả thi của sinh viên d. Kết xuất báo cáo
Báo cáo được thu thập bằng cách tập hợp dữ liệu theo các tiêu chí do người dùng đặt ra. Báo cáo thường được in ra hay hiển thị trên màn hình theo khuôn mẫu định sẵn.
Ví dụ: báo cáo số lượng và tổng tiền của từng sản phẩm